Core Services Offered by Managed IT Providers in NYC
Okay, so youre thinking about Managed IT Services in NYC, right? Its not just about someone showing up when your computer crashes (though thats part of it!). Think of it as outsourcing your entire IT department. Instead of hiring a full team in-house, you pay a managed service provider (MSP) a monthly fee to handle all things tech.
One of the biggest things to understand is the core services they usually offer. These are the bread and butter, the things almost every provider will include. First, theres network monitoring and management. This is like the vital signs checkup for your network. Theyre constantly watching for problems, like slow speeds, outages, or security threats (keeping your data safe is a huge deal).
Then youve got help desk support. This is your go-to for day-to-day issues. Your printer not working? Cant access a file? The help desk is there to troubleshoot and get you back on track. Its faster than trying to figure it all out yourself, which saves you time and frustration.
Another crucial piece is server management. If your business relies on servers (whether theyre physical or in the cloud), the MSP will handle maintenance, updates, and security. They make sure everything is running smoothly and that your data is backed up regularly (because losing data is a nightmare).
Cybersecurity is also a major core service. This includes things like firewall management, anti-virus software, intrusion detection, and security awareness training for your employees. Theyre constantly working to protect your business from cyber threats, which are unfortunately, a real and growing concern these days.
Finally, data backup and disaster recovery is a standard offering. This ensures that even in the event of a major disaster (like a fire, flood, or ransomware attack), your data is safe and recoverable. Theyll have a plan in place to get your business back up and running as quickly as possible (business continuity is the name of the game here).
Beyond these core services, some providers may offer additional services like cloud migration, VoIP phone systems, or project management. But those core elements are typically the foundation of any good Managed IT Services agreement in NYC. So, when youre shopping around, make sure you understand whats included in those core offerings – it can make a big difference!

Now, lets delve deeper into those cybersecurity measures included in managed IT packages, as promised. These are absolutely essential in todays threat landscape. Often, these measures will include:
- Antivirus and anti-malware software: This is your first line of defense against viruses, malware, and other malicious software. (Regular updates are key to its effectiveness!)
- Firewall management: A properly configured firewall acts as a barrier between your network and the outside world, blocking unauthorized access. (Managed IT providers will monitor and maintain your firewall to ensure its working effectively.)
- Intrusion detection and prevention systems (IDS/IPS): These systems monitor network traffic for suspicious activity and automatically take action to block or mitigate threats. (They act like a security guard for your network.)
- Security awareness training for employees: Your employees are often the weakest link in your cybersecurity defenses. Training them to recognize phishing emails, avoid suspicious links, and follow security best practices is crucial. (Human error is a major cause of data breaches.)
- Vulnerability scanning and penetration testing: These activities identify weaknesses in your systems and applications that could be exploited by attackers. (Its like a simulated attack to find holes in your defenses.)

Network Monitoring and Management Services
Network Monitoring and Management Services are absolutely vital when considering "What is Included in Managed IT Services NYC?" Think of it like this: your network is the circulatory system of your business, carrying all the vital data and applications that keep everything running. If that system gets clogged, damaged, or infected, your whole operation suffers. Network Monitoring and Management Services, therefore, act as the doctors and paramedics of your network, constantly watching, diagnosing, and treating any potential ailments.
What does that actually mean though? Well, it includes a whole suite of activities. Continuous monitoring (24/7 is ideal) uses specialized software to track network performance, looking at things like bandwidth usage, server uptime, and application response times. If something goes wrong – a server crashes, internet connectivity drops, or a security threat emerges – the monitoring system immediately alerts the IT team. (Think of it like a sophisticated alarm system for your digital infrastructure.)
But its not just about reacting to problems. Management is just as crucial. This involves proactive maintenance and optimization. (Like going to the gym to stay healthy instead of just going to the doctor when youre already sick.) This could involve regularly patching software to address security vulnerabilities, optimizing network configurations to improve performance, and proactively identifying and resolving potential bottlenecks before they cause major disruptions.
Furthermore, good network monitoring and management includes detailed reporting. You need to know whats happening with your network, even if youre not a tech expert. Regular reports should provide insights into network performance, security incidents, and overall health, allowing you to make informed decisions about your IT infrastructure. (This is like getting a comprehensive health checkup report from your doctor.)
In short, Network Monitoring and Management Services, as part of Managed IT Services in NYC, provide the peace of mind of knowing that your network is being constantly watched over, proactively maintained, and quickly repaired when problems arise. Its about ensuring your business runs smoothly and efficiently, without the constant worry of network-related disruptions.
Data Backup and Disaster Recovery Solutions
Data Backup and Disaster Recovery Solutions: In the whirlwind of New York Citys business scene, losing data is more than just an inconvenience; its a potential catastrophe. Thats why data backup and disaster recovery solutions are a crucial component of managed IT services in NYC. Think of it as your businesss digital safety net (essential for peace of mind).
What exactly does this entail? Well, its not just about making copies of your files (although thats a big part of it!). A robust solution involves regular, automated backups of your critical data. These backups can be stored locally, in the cloud, or, ideally, both (offering redundancy and faster recovery options). The "what" to back up is also important, including databases, applications, virtual servers, and user data.
But simply having backups isnt enough. A comprehensive disaster recovery plan is equally vital. This plan outlines the steps to take in the event of a disaster, whether its a hardware failure, a cyberattack, or even a natural disaster (something NYC is certainly no stranger to). The plan sets out how quickly your business can restore its systems and data (recovery time objective) and how much data loss is acceptable (recovery point objective).
Managed IT providers will often test the disaster recovery plan regularly (think of it as a fire drill for your data), ensuring its effective and up-to-date. Theyll also monitor your systems for potential threats and vulnerabilities (proactive security measures), minimizing the risk of data loss in the first place. So, when you consider managed IT services in NYC, remember that data backup and disaster recovery are not just add-ons; theyre essential safeguards for your businesss future.

Benefits of Comprehensive Managed IT Services
The benefits of comprehensive managed IT services are substantial. First and foremost, it provides peace of mind. Knowing that your IT infrastructure is being monitored and maintained by experts allows you to focus on your core business activities without worrying about technical glitches or security threats. (Thats time and energy better spent on growing your business!).
Cost savings are another significant advantage. While you pay a monthly fee, managed IT can actually save you money in the long run by preventing costly downtime, reducing the need for emergency repairs, and optimizing your IT infrastructure. You avoid the unpredictable costs of the break-fix model.
Improved productivity is a direct result of having a reliable and efficient IT infrastructure. When your systems are running smoothly and your employees have access to the tools they need, they can be more productive and efficient. (Think of the hours wasted on troubleshooting technical issues!).
Enhanced security is perhaps the most critical benefit. Managed IT services provide robust security measures to protect your business from cyber threats, data breaches, and other security risks. This is especially important in todays digital landscape, where cyberattacks are becoming increasingly sophisticated.
